What is Cloud Security Incident Runbook?
A Cloud Security Incident Runbook is a structured guide designed to help organizations respond effectively to security incidents in cloud environments. With the increasing adoption of cloud services, the complexity of managing security incidents has grown exponentially. This runbook provides predefined steps and protocols to address various scenarios, such as unauthorized access, data breaches, and misconfigurations. By leveraging industry best practices, it ensures that teams can act swiftly and decisively during critical moments. For instance, in a scenario where sensitive data is exposed due to a misconfigured storage bucket, the runbook outlines immediate containment measures, communication protocols, and long-term remediation strategies. Why use this Cloud Security Incident Runbook?
The Cloud Security Incident Runbook addresses specific pain points associated with managing security incidents in cloud environments. One major challenge is the lack of standardized procedures, which can lead to delayed responses and increased damage. This runbook provides a clear, step-by-step approach to incident management, ensuring that all team members are aligned. Another issue is the difficulty in coordinating cross-functional teams during an incident. The runbook includes predefined communication protocols, making it easier to collaborate effectively. Additionally, it helps organizations comply with regulatory requirements by documenting actions taken during an incident. For instance, during a ransomware attack, the runbook guides teams through containment, eradication, and recovery phases, minimizing downtime and data loss.
